Reid and GOP in a Showdown
Roll Call Staff
Senate Republicans scrambled Tuesday to avoid the ire of AARP and veterans, offering to support payments to 20 million low- income seniors and 250,000 disabled vets left out of the House stimulus package, while hoping to hold the line against unemployment insurance, energy tax breaks and other goodies backed by Senate Democrats and the Finance Committee.
